Side) COMMON ORDER The 1st accused has filed Crl.O.P.No.2207 of 2024, the 6th accused has filed Crl.O.P.No.2306 and the 5th accused has filed Crl.O.P.No.2305 of 2024, all in Crime No.08 of 2024, registered by the respondent for the offences under Sections 143, 341, 294(b), 336, 353, 506(2) of IPC, seek bail. They had been remanded to custody on 13.01.2024. 2.It is stated that the petitioners and the other accused, who are students of Presidency College, were travelling in a bus in Route No.29A and had climbed to the top of the bus and threatened other passengers and were hanging in dangerous manner. Some of the accused had ran away and some of them/these petitioners had been secured and remanded to 2/5

custody.

3.Taking all the factors into consideration, I am inclined to grant bail to the petitioner in all the criminal original petitions subject to the following conditions:

4.Accordingly, the petitioner in all the criminal original petitions are ordered to be released on bail on condition to execute separate bond for a sum of Rs.10,000/- (Rupees Ten Thousand only) each with two sureties, each for a like sum to the satisfaction of the II Metropolitan Magistrate, Egmore, Chennai, and on further conditions that: - [a] the sureties shall affix their photographs and Left Thumb Impression in the surety bond and the Magistrate may obtain a copy of their Aadhar card or Bank pass Book to ensure their identity. [b] the petitioners shall report before the respondent police everyday at 05.30 p.m., for a period of three weeks and thereafter, as and when required for interrogation.

[c] The learned II Metropolitan Magistrate, Egmore, Chennai, may inform the Principal, Presidency College, Chennai, that the petitioners herein, are accused in Crime No.08 of 2024, registered for the offences under Sections 143, 341, 294(b), 336, 353, 506(2) of IPC and the Principal of Presidency College, Chennai, is directed to 3/5

record the above details in the College Register of these petitioners and mention it in every certificate issued to the petitioners. [d] the petitioners shall not abscond either during investigation or trial.

[e] the petitioners shall not tamper with evidence or witness either during investigation or trial.

[f] On breach of any of the aforesaid conditions, the learned Magistrate/Trial Court is entitled to take appropriate action against the petitioners in accordance with law as if the conditions have been imposed and the petitioners released on bail by the learned Magistrate/Trial Court himself as laid down by the Hon'ble Supreme Court in P.K.Shaji vs. State of Kerala [(2005)AIR SCW 5560].

[g] If the accused thereafter absconds, a fresh FIR can be registered under Section 229A IPC.
